Sustainability, hunger, wellbeing and equity, diversity and inclusion are all interconnected. Our changing climate is impacting the health of people and reducing crop yields, leading to greater food insecurity. Many diverse and underserved communities are disproportionally impacted by climate change and now face higher barriers to health and access to nutritious foods. And these same communities are most at risk for undernutrition, hidden hunger and obesity.

For these reasons, our Kellogg’s Better Days® Promise aims to:

  • Reduce absolute Scope 1 & 2 gre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ions by 45% by the end of 2030.
  • Partner across our value chain to reduce absolute Scope 3 GHG emissions by 15% by the end of 2030.
  • Progress towards 100% renewable electricity in global Kellogg manufacturing facilities by the end of 2050.
  • Reduce water use in global Kellogg manufacturing facilities in high water stress regions by 30% by the end of 2030.
  • Reduce food waste across our global Kellogg-owned manufacturing facilities by 50% by the end of 2030.
  • Support farmers and agronomists globally, including women and smallholders.
  • Build resilient and responsible supply chains for our priority ingredients.
  • Work towards 100% reusable, recyclable or compostable packaging (by volume).

Our Progress (as of December 2022)
  • 33% absolute reduction in Scope 1 and 2 GHG emissions (since 2015)
  • 13% absolute reduction in Scope 3 GHG emissions (since 2015, as of December 2021)
  • 40.3% of electricity used from renewable sources (in 2022)
  • 17% reduction of water use in high-stress regions (since 2015)
  • 23% reduction in food waste (since 2016, as of December 2021)
  • 485,000 farmers and agronomists supported (since 2015)
  • 76% of packaging is recyclable (at scale, in 2021)
